Download Android 9 Pie for Huawei Mate 10 and Mate 10 Pro

Good News for Huawei Mate 10 Pro users. Huawei has started rolling Android 9.0 Pie beta update for Huawei Mate 10 Pro with EMUI 9.0 under the skin. The update is started labeling with build number which is currently rolling for Europe region and will soon start rolling in other parts of the world. Now you can grab the download link from below which brings the latest Android 9 Pie for Huawei Mate 10 Pro device. You can check the changelog here.

The update is rolling via OTA (over the air) in a phase-wise manner and will soon reach every user with the stable version of Android 8.0 Oreo. The download is available and supported for both the Huawei Mate 10 (ALP-L09 and ALP-L29) Huawei Mate 10 Pro (BLA-L09 and BLA-L29).

EMUI 9.0 will bring a significant improvement to the overall performance of the device with Android 9.0 Pie OS. With EMUI 9.0, Huawei has added new gesture setup for Multi-task-switching between each app and new improved GPU Turbo 2.0 also marks its presence to provide the users with a seamless and comprehensive gaming experience. In addition, EMUI 9.0 also puts emphasis on improvement in the security and promotes digital health.

Along with EMUI 9.0 features, Android 9.0 Pie brings gesture-based navigation system. Other features of Android 9 Pie are New Quick Settings UI design, Redesigned volume slider, Advanced Battery with AI Support, Notch Support, Improved Adaptive Brightness, Manual theme selection, Android Dashboard which Google calls Digital Wellbeing, and more other features.

Download B108 Android 9 Pie for Huawei Mate 10 Pro

Download Android Pie Full OTA Zip

Huawei Mate 10 Android 9.0 Pie Update

ALP-L29C185E2R1P12B177 ( – Middle East

ALP-L09C346E3R1P9B178 ( – Ausralia

ALP-AL00C00E85R1P20B167 ( – China

ALP-AL00C00E85R2P20B167 ( China

ALP-TL00C00E85R2P20B167 ( China

ALP-L29C636E2R1P12B159 ( – Asia

ALP-L29C605E2R1P11B159 ( – Latin America

ALP-L09C69E4R1P9B159 ( – Mexico

ALP-AL00C00E84R2P20B156 ( China

ALP-TL00C00E84R2P20B156 ( China

ALP-AL00C00E84R1P20B156 ( China

ALP-AL00C00E81R2P20B125 ( – China

ALP-TL00C00E81R2P20B125 ( – China

ALP-AL00C00E81R2P20B120 ( – China

ALP-TL00C00E81R2P20B120 ( China

ALP-L09C432E4R1P8B108-log ( Europe

ALP-L29C636E2R1P8B108-log ( Asia

ALP-L29C185E2R1P8B109-log ( Middle East

ALP-TL00C01E80R1P19B110 ( China

ALP-AL00C00E80R2P19B110 ( China

ALP-AL00C00E81R2P20B120 ( China

ALP-TL00C00E81R2P20B120 ( China

Huawei Mate 10 Pro Android 9.0 Pie Update

BLA-A09C797E2R1P11B201 ( – USA

BLA-A09C567E6R1P11B201 ( – USA

BLA-L29C432E4R1P11B197 ( – Europe

BLA-L09C432E4R1P11B197 ( – Europe

BLA-L29C432E4R1P11B179 (

BLA-L09C432E4R1P11B179 (

BLA-L29C576E2R1P7B179 (

BLA-L09C109E6R1P11B179 ( – Orange Carrier

BLA-L09C185E2R1P13B177 (

BLA-L29C185E2R1P13B177 (

BLA-L09C521E5R1P11B168 ( – Telefonica, LA

BLA-L29C33E3R1P11B168 ( – Altice

BLA-L09C782E4R1P11B168 ( – Europe

BLA-L09C45E3R1P11B168 ( – Tigo, LA

BLA-L09C771E4R1P11B161 ( – Latin America

BLA-L09C432E4R1P11B161 ( – Europe

BLA-L29C432E4R1P11B161 ( – Europe

BLA-L09C55E4R1P11B159 ( – Italy

BLA-L09C771E5R1P11B168 ( – Latin America

BLA-AL00C786E87R1P15B167 ( – China

BLA-TL00C01E87R1P15B167 ( – China

BLA-AL00C01E87R1P15B167 ( – China

BLA-L29C185E2R1P13B159 ( – Middle East

BLA-L09C185E2R1P13B159 ( – Middle East

BLA-L09C25E5R1P11B159 ( – Claro, Latin America

BLA-L29C10E2R1P13B159 ( – Russia

BLA-L09C316E4R1P11B159 ( – Vodacom Brazil

BLA-L29C636E2R1P13B159 ( – Asia

BLA-AL00C00E86R2P15B156 ( – China

BLA-TL00C00E86R2P15B156 ( – China

BLA-AL00C786E86R2P15B156 ( – China

BLA-AL00C786E83R2P15B125 ( – China

BLA-TL00C01E83R1P15B125 ( – China

BLA-AL00C01E83R1P15B125 ( – China

BLA-AL00C786E83R1P15B125 ( – China

BLA-AL00C786E82R2P15B120 ( – China

BLA-L29C10E2R1P8B112 ( – Russia

BLA-AL00C00E81R2P14B110 ( – China

BLA-AL00C00E81R2P14B110 ( – China

BLA-L09C605E2R1P8B108-log ( – Latin America

BLA-L09C185E2R1P8B108-log ( – Middle East

BLA-L29C185E2R1P8B108-log ( – Middle East

BLA-L09C432E4R1P8B108-log – – Europe

BLA-L29C432E4R1P8B108-log – – Europe

BLA-AL00C00E82R2P15B120 ( – China

BLA-TL00C00E82R2P15B120 ( – China

BLA-AL00C786E82R2P15B120 ( – China

BLA-AL00C786E82R2P15B120 ( – China

Steps to Install Android 9 Pie for Huawei Mate 10 and Mate 10 Pro


If you have an unlocked bootloader and rooted? If yes! Great, here we go. If you didn’t unlock, then we are sorry. Since May 25, 2018, No More Bootloader Unlocking for Huawei devices. 

  • Download Beta Flashy v0.2
  • Download the Huawei USB Drivers and install on your PC
  • First, activate the Developer Option
  • Now Enable USB debugging and OEM Unlock.
  • Download the required ROM file
  • Charge your phone to at least 50% before trying this.


  • First, you need to download EMUI 9.0 Beta Flashy v0.2 and extract on your PC’
  • Download the firmware and extract it inside the same flashing tool extracted area.
  • You need to enable OEM unlocking and USB Debugging on your device
  • Once you have enabled OEM unlocking, now open the flashy tool and run the Flash.bat file inside it.
  • This will now flash the Android 9 Pie Update on Huawei Mate 10 Pro
  • Once it is done! Reboot your device and enjoy the Android Pie EMUI 9.0 beta.
  • That’s it! You have successfully flashed the Android Pie.

[su_note note_color=”#fefef3″ text_color=”#000000″]If the above method doesn’t work for you, then follow our guide to install via HuRUpdater Tool or dload method.[/su_note]

I hope the guide was helpful to download and install Android Pie on your device.


  1. Hello,

    I have Mate 10 Pro, based in Europe.
    Tried dload as well as original method bu it does fastboot.
    Device is not detected.
    How do I force update it?

    Can you let me know?

Leave a Reply

Your email address will not be published.

This site uses Akismet to reduce spam. Learn how your comment data is processed.